Rogers Group, Inc., headquartered in Nashville, is a privately held aggregates and asphalt highway construction company operating in 12 states with over 3,000 employees. RGI, established in 1908, has the distinction of being recognized as the largest privately held aggregate producer in the United States.

We have 86 quarries and 56 asphalt plants across Tennessee, Mississippi, Georgia, Alabama, South Carolina, North Carolina, Kentucky, Arkansas, Texas, Indiana, Illinois, and Ohio.

Rogers Group is currently seeking a Treasury Supervisor to join our Finance team and take ownership of critical cash management and treasury operations. This role will play a key part in managing daily cash flows, overseeing revolver borrowings, coordinating intercompany cash activity, and maintaining key treasury systems and processes. The ideal candidate is highly organized, detail-oriented, and able to manage multiple priorities in a fast-growing environment.

 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Monitor and forecast daily cash positions across multiple bank accounts and entities.

  • Initiate and track cash transfers, wires, and ACH payments.

  • Manage revolver borrowings and repayments to optimize liquidity and minimize interest expense.

  • Track compliance with debt covenants and reporting requirements.

  • Coordinate intercompany funding, lease payments, and cash settlements.

  • Maintain intercompany balances and support monthly close processes.

  • Administer the corporate PCard system, including user setup, policy enforcement, and reporting. 

  • Administer company merchant services process, including setups and replacements, transaction processing, adherence to contract requirements, and reconciliations.

  • Ensure accurate and timely treasury-related journal entries and documentation.

  • Prepare and reconcile monthly cash activity to the general ledger.

  • Assist with month-end and quarter-end reporting packages and cash flow analysis.

  • Manage local banking relationships for quarry operations, including account maintenance, deposit activity, and service issues.
